- [ ] Verify the Ledgerlight audit-log viewer renders redacted fields as opaque placeholders in every export format, including the printable summary, and confirm that no redacted value survives in browser memory after the session ends. Exercise this with the adversarial fixture set from the Hallowmere review, not the demo data. Record pass/fail against the candidate build identified by the token below.

trace token, fafog-kageg: htk4_98e6

## Support

The Tidewren plugin framework handles date localization through the `localeFormat` helper; plugin authors should never hard-code date patterns, as host applications may override regional settings at runtime. Consult the formatting reference in the developer guide before filing an issue. If you encounter locale data that renders incorrectly despite correct helper usage, contact the framework maintainers.

escalation mailbox, kadup-fajof: ulador@qirvanlabs.corp

Subject: Handover — replica lag alarm on Quillbase

Tomas,

The read-replica lag alarm for Quillbase prod fired twice overnight. Lag peaked at 14 minutes, recovered on its own both times. Likely cause: the nightly Ledgerfox export saturating WAL shipping. I bumped the alarm threshold to 5 minutes temporarily — revert after the export moves to the new window Thursday.

If it fires again, check replication slots before restarting anything. Connect to the replica directly using the string below.

— Priya

primary connection of yagep-kahip = redis://giliel_svc:zYiKsLL2PLpfPL@db-348f.xolmarsys.corp:5432/fenwyn

**CI note: greenhouse drift tests flaking**

The Verdantloop controller's sensor-drift regression suite fails intermittently on runner pool B. Cause: the synthetic humidity ramp uses wall-clock sleeps, and slow runners push readings outside the drift-compensation window. Fix in review swaps to simulated time. Do not block the release on pool B failures; pool A is green. The last fully green run is stamped with the build token below.

session token of bawep-yadup = htk21_528abd376e3c5a4ec24a1